Ticket: Config drift on Marrowtide ORM refactor

Heads up — staging and prod have drifted again while we've been refactoring the legacy ORM layer. Please don't copy settings by hand; it's how we got here. Use the baseline file checked into the repo. Current prod values are shown below for comparison.

deployment values, yadup-kadug:
[sorys]
port = 5672
team = noveth
host = sorys.orvexcorp.example
region = south-4
access_code = ac_deddc1
timeout_ms = 1500

So you've been handed the fun job of carving the user module out of the Oakbarrel monolith. Quick rules: the new Userhive service owns writes first, reads stay dual-sourced until parity checks pass for a full week. Never flip the read traffic flag on a Friday. Migrations run via the shadow pipeline, and every cutover step needs a rollback note. The whole cutover sequence is spelled out on the internal migration page.

operations page: https://jenkins.zemvarcloud.local/job/merge_requests/repo/build/73930b4b30f0a8ed

# Fleet fuel-usage report — Haverline Transit internal tooling
# This env file configures the nightly job that pulls odometer and
# fuel-card data from the Grumman depot exporter and builds the weekly
# usage report for dispatch. As a contractor you only need read access;
# the scheduler handles everything else. The exporter requires an API
# credential to authenticate, so the next line sets it.

sealed setting: ARCHIVE_KEY3=8d0